    Importance of Relay Lifespan Testing
    Relays operate by using an electromagnet to move a switch between two or more contacts, controlling the flow of electrical current. The lifespan of a relay is determined by several factors, including the number of switching cycles, the type of load it handles, and environmental conditions such as temperature, humidity, and vibration. Over time, the mechanical components within the relay may wear out, and the contacts may degrade, which can result in malfunction or failure. For instance, in critical applications such as automotive systems or power distribution, a faulty relay can lead to system downtime or even catastrophic failures.
